Clothing is another key factor. What someone wears often influences how they sit. Skirts and dresses, for instance, naturally encourage crossing the legs as a way to maintain modesty and avoid unwanted exposure. Over time, this practical adjustment can turn into a habit that carries over even when it’s no longer necessary.
